* {
  margin: 0;
  padding: 0;
  box-sizing: border-box;
}

body {
  background-color: #f3e5d8;
}

h1,
h2,
h3 {
  font-family: "Young Serif", serif;
}

p {
  font-family: "Outfit", sans-serif;
  color: #575351;
}

#recipe-card {
  background-color: #fff;
  margin: 4rem auto;
  width: 735px;
  border-radius: 20px;

}

.recipe-card-content {
  padding: 2.5rem;
}

.omlette-img {
  width: 655px;
  border-radius: 7px;

}

.main-header {
  color: #2a2827;
  margin: 1rem 0rem;
}

.preperation-time-container {
  margin: 2rem 0rem;
  background-color: #fff7fc;
  border-radius: 7px;
  padding: 1.5rem 0rem 1.5rem 3rem;

}

.prep-time-heading {
  font-family: "Outfit", sans-serif;
  color: #6f103D;
}

li {
  font-family: "Outfit", sans-serif;
  padding-left: 1rem;
  margin: 1rem 0rem;
  color: #575351;
}

li::marker {
  color: #6f103D;
}

.bold-text {
  font-weight: bold;
}

.gold-text {
  color: #7e5039;
}

.gold-list li::marker {
  color: #7e5039;
  font-weight: bold;
}

.divider {
  background: #e2e2e2;
  height: 1px;
  margin: 2rem 0rem;
}

.nutrition-p {
  margin: 1rem 0rem;
}

.nutrition-table {
  margin-top: 2rem;
}

.nutrition-card {
  display: flex;
}

.macro-p {
  width: 350px;
  padding-left: 2rem;
}

.mobile-omlette-img {
  display: none;
}

/* 




Media Queries





*/

@media screen and (max-width: 700px) {

  #recipe-card {
    margin: 0rem auto;
    width: 100%;
    border-radius: 0px;
  }

  .omlette-img {
    display: none;
  }

  .mobile-omlette-img {
    display: block;
    width: 100%;
  }

  .preperation-time-container {
    padding: 1.5rem 2rem 1.5rem 3rem;

  }

}